How Common Is The Last Name Obiyo? popularity and diffusion
The surname is the 135,976th most prevalent last name on a global scale. It is borne by around 1 in 2,206,341 people. It is primarily found in Africa, where 99 percent of Obiyo live; 97 percent live in West Africa and 97 percent live in Atlantic-Niger Africa. It is also the 868,627th most commonly used first name world-wide, borne by 116 people.
The last name is most commonly occurring in Nigeria, where it is carried by 3,206 people, or 1 in 55,254. In Nigeria it is most common in: Imo, where 61 percent reside, Anambra, where 8 percent reside and Abia, where 5 percent reside. Excluding Nigeria this surname exists in 11 countries. It is also found in Uganda, where 1 percent reside and The United States, where 1 percent reside.
